I just drove by there today and went into the construction area. It looks like they have asphalt down on about 1/4 of the track. Much of the track is still being built up with dirt and corrugated drainage pipes. The good news is that a lot of construction loaders and cats were out there working away, but it will be a close call to have it all done by this year. On another note, exept for the bowl it looks like the concrete barriers are on the inside of the track.
